#The Cell

SYDNEY, AUSTRALIA

Following his first inflatable work, Jumping Castle War Memorial, Andrew’s second inflatable work titled The Cell was commissioned by the Sherman Contemporary Art Foundation. The Cell is a 3 x 12 x 6m inflatable room, adorned inside and out with the Wiradjuri pattern that appears in many of Andrew’s works. In order to enter The Cell, participants are required to also wear the design, with Wiradjuri jumpsuits provided in a variety of colours.

UAP collaborated with Andrew to realise the artwork, undertaking form studies, developing concept sketches and 3D renders, and managing fabrication to ensure adherence to safety standards.
